The quality of drinking water in Ukraine is rapidly deteriorating.

Ukrainians will face a shortage of clean water in the next decades and will be forced to drink only bottled water. The head of the committee for the protection of water resources of the International Association of Environmental Professionals, Maryana Hinzula, told Ukrainian Radio.

She explained that the quality of water resources is affected by everything that happens on the surface of the earth, including military operations, which are accompanied by the use of a large number of weapons.

Water runoff per person is less than 2 thousand cubic metres of surface runoff. Therefore, already after 2031-2050 water deficit in Ukraine will be 61-71 per cent. Already today water has become dirtier as a result of a full-scale war, and in five years it will reach its peak, as groundwater has the ability to infiltrate what is happening on the surface," the expert pointed out.

She stressed that every missile that flew into the Ukrainian airspace has a destructive impact on the ecology and noted that the destructive impact on the ecology due to the war will be felt more strongly in the future.

The missile that flew over Kiev has already had its delayed impact to a certain extent. It's just that it's not happening all at once, but slowly. All the things that happened in Bucha, in Irpen, two years later appeared in the river," the expert explained.

Hinzula pointed out that the main problem of water resources is iron and rust in the water.

It is especially relevant for Kiev. The capital consumes 60% of its water from the Desna and the remaining 30% from the Dnieper. In different regions the situation with drinking water depends on the state of the main water arteries," the expert said.

She added that the cleanest rivers in Chernihiv Region remain today.
